GL_CURRENT_RASTER_DISTANCE
params returns one value, the distance from the eye to the current raster position. The
initial value is 0. See glRasterPos.
GL_CURRENT_RASTER_INDEX
params returns one value, the color index of the current raster position. The initial value
is 1. See glRasterPos.
GL_CURRENT_RASTER_POSITION
params returns four values: the x, y, z, and w components of the current raster position.
x, y, and z are in window coordinates, and w is in clip coordinates. The initial value is (0,
0, 0, 1). See glRasterPos.
GL_CURRENT_RASTER_POSITION_VALID
params returns a single boolean value indicating whether the current raster position is
valid. The initial value is GL_TRUE. See glRasterPos.
GL_CURRENT_RASTER_TEXTURE_COORDS
params returns four values: the s, t, r, and q current raster texture coordinates. The
initial value is (0, 0, 0, 1). See glRasterPos and glTexCoord.
GL_CURRENT_TEXTURE_COORDS
params returns four values: the s, t, r, and q current texture coordinates. The initial
value is (0, 0, 0, 1). See glTexCoord.
GL_DEPTH_BIAS
params returns one value, the depth bias factor used during pixel transfers. The initial
value is 0. See glPixelTransfer.
GL_DEPTH_BITS
params returns one value, the number of bitplanes in the depth buffer.
GL_DEPTH_CLEAR_VALUE
params returns one value, the value that is used to clear the depth buffer. Integer
values, if requested, are linearly mapped from the internal floating-point representation
such that 1.0 returns the most positive representable integer value, and - 1.0 returns the
most negative representable integer value. The initial value is 1. See glClearDepth.
GL_DEPTH_FUNC
params returns one value, the symbolic constant that indicates the depth comparison
function. The initial value is GL_LESS. See glDepthFunc.
GL_DEPTH_RANGE
params returns two values: the near and far mapping limits for the depth buffer. Integer
values, if requested, are linearly mapped from the internal floating-point representation
such that 1.0 returns the most positive representable integer value, and - 1.0 returns the
most negative representable integer value. The initial value is (0, 1). See glDepthRange.
